    It's kinda cool that they genuinely do cross Waterloo station from one end to the other, with pretty much perfect continuity and geographical accuracy, and in about the time it really takes. The layout is a bit different now, but the bridge to the concourse is still there at one end, and the off-license at the other. A lot of films and TV shows go the easy route and jump backwards and forwards between locations as needed (I saw a lot of this recently in the London scenes in Moon Knight), but in Bourne they made the effort to keep it accurate.
